von pichel » Sa 26. Apr 2025, 16:01
Hallo,
ich weiß, dass das eigentlich nach einer einfachen Funktion klingt. Sie ist auch nicht unmöglich einzubauen, aber erfordert doch einen gewissen Programmieraufwand, weil dann
- eine weitere Sortierreihenfolge eingefügt werden muss (aktuell kennt das Kassendruckmodul nur Artikel, aber nicht die Bemerkungen zu den Artikeln und/oder Bestellungen). Das heißt, ich muss ganz anders die Artikel gruppieren, denn ein Kassenbon kann ja aus verschiedenen Einzelbestellungen zusammengesetzt sein, die wiederum unterschiedliche Kommentare haben
- die Druckvorlage muss um eine Ebene "Bestellung" erweitert werden. Die Druckvorlage muss dann natürlich auch technisch umgesetzt werden. Es ist auch etwas herausfordernd, Kompatibilität zu den "alten" Druckvorlagen sicherzustellen. Eventuell geht das gar nicht.
- bei Dingen, die so wichtig sind wie die Kassenbons, mache ich jetzt immer automatisierte Tests, um sicherzustellen, dass bei zukünftigen Erweiterungen nicht bestehende umsatzrelevante Funktionen kaputtgehen ("Regressionstests").
Langer Rede, kurzer Sinn: Es wäre eine größere Änderung, die ich mit der aktuell verfügbaren Freizeit nicht schaffe.
Schöne Grüße,
Stefan
Hallo,
ich weiß, dass das eigentlich nach einer einfachen Funktion klingt. Sie ist auch nicht unmöglich einzubauen, aber erfordert doch einen gewissen Programmieraufwand, weil dann
- eine weitere Sortierreihenfolge eingefügt werden muss (aktuell kennt das Kassendruckmodul nur Artikel, aber nicht die Bemerkungen zu den Artikeln und/oder Bestellungen). Das heißt, ich muss ganz anders die Artikel gruppieren, denn ein Kassenbon kann ja aus verschiedenen Einzelbestellungen zusammengesetzt sein, die wiederum unterschiedliche Kommentare haben
- die Druckvorlage muss um eine Ebene "Bestellung" erweitert werden. Die Druckvorlage muss dann natürlich auch technisch umgesetzt werden. Es ist auch etwas herausfordernd, Kompatibilität zu den "alten" Druckvorlagen sicherzustellen. Eventuell geht das gar nicht.
- bei Dingen, die so wichtig sind wie die Kassenbons, mache ich jetzt immer automatisierte Tests, um sicherzustellen, dass bei zukünftigen Erweiterungen nicht bestehende umsatzrelevante Funktionen kaputtgehen ("Regressionstests").
Langer Rede, kurzer Sinn: Es wäre eine größere Änderung, die ich mit der aktuell verfügbaren Freizeit nicht schaffe.
Schöne Grüße,
Stefan